The Rise of Bitcoin-Backed Loans

Bitcoin-backed loans have emerged as a competitive alternative to traditional fixed-income products.

Here's why they're gaining traction:

  1. Higher Yields: While traditional bonds struggle in the low-interest-rate environment, Bitcoin-backed loans are delivering yields ranging from 7.5% to 12.5%.

  2. Risk Mitigation: These loans are typically over-collateralized, providing a safety net for lenders.

  3. 24/7 Liquidity: Unlike traditional assets, Bitcoin can be liquidated at any time, offering enhanced flexibility in managing portfolio risk.

  4. Institutional Adoption: Major players like Goldman Sachs are taking substantial positions in Bitcoin ETFs, signaling growing confidence in crypto as an asset class
